AFRICANS- COUP: NIGER REPUBLIC REMAINS CONDEMNED AND CALL ON THE MILITARY……….

By: Safiya Abdulrahim Dabban.           08036377731

A Pan African Movement Africans Rising for Unity, Justice, Peace & Dignity says the military take-over of political power in Niger Republic remained condemned and called on the military officers to allow a peaceful resolution to the stalemate and return the country to civilian rule.

In a statement, the organisation urges the international and regional bodies including ECOWAS and African Union to sustain constructive engagements with all relevant actors to maintain peace and stability.

The statement however expressed disagreement with the threats of military intervention by ECOWAS members describing the action as capable of the death of innocent people and the destruction of the country.

It also called on ECOWAS and the AU to be more proactive in dealing with crises within the region and across Africa instead of reacting to situations after they deteriorate.

The organisation called on External powers from West the and East to steer clear of Africa’s internal affairs and desist from making reckless statements hinting at military action.

African Rising is a Pan-African movement of people and organisations, working for peace, justice and dignity.
